Who united Egypt, and how did he do this?

Narmer united Upper Egypt and Lower Egypt by conquering lower Egypt and marrying one of its princesses.

Why was a unified and stable government important to the development of ancient Egypt?

The government oversaw the construction of irrigation ditches and dams and developed mans for storing grain and distributing food in times of famine. It also settled conflicts over land ownership.
